| /* |
| * The mainboard must define strings in the root scope to |
| * report device-specific battery information to the OS. |
| * |
| * BATV: Vendor |
| */ |
| |
| // Scope (EC0) |
| |
| Device (BATX) |
| { |
| Name (_HID, EISAID ("PNP0C0A")) |
| Name (_UID, 1) |
| Name (_PCL, Package () { \_SB }) |
| |
| Name (PBIF, Package () { |
| 0x00000001, // 0 Power Unit: mAh |
| 0xFFFFFFFF, // 1 Design Capacity |
| 0xFFFFFFFF, // 2 Last Full Charge Capacity |
| 0x00000001, // 3 Battery Technology: Rechargeable |
| 0xFFFFFFFF, // 4 Design Voltage |
| 0x000000FA, // 5 Design Capacity of Warning |
| 0x00000096, // 6 Design Capacity of Low |
| 0x0000000A, // 7 Capacity Granularity 1 |
| 0x00000019, // 8 Capacity Granularity 2 |
| "", // 9 Model Number |
| "", // 10 Serial Number |
| "", // 11 Battery Type |
| "" // 12 OEM Information |
| }) |
| |
| Name (PBST, Package () { |
| 0x00000000, // Battery State |
| 0xFFFFFFFF, // Battery Present Rate |
| 0xFFFFFFFF, // Battery Remaining Capacity |
| 0xFFFFFFFF, // Battery Present Voltage |
| }) |
| |
| // Workaround for full battery status, enabled by default |
| Name (BFWK, One) |
| |
| // Method to enable full battery workaround |
| Method (BFWE) |
| { |
| Store (One, BFWK) |
| } |
| |
| // Method to disable full battery workaround |
| Method (BFWD) |
| { |
| Store (Zero, BFWK) |
| } |
| |
| // Device insertion/removal control method that returns a device’s status. |
| // Power resource object that evaluates to the current on or off state of |
| // the Power Resource. |
| Method (_STA, 0, Serialized) |
| { |
| If (BTIN) { |
| Return (0x1F) |
| } Else { |
| Return (0x0F) |
| } |
| } |
| |
| Method (_BIF, 0, Serialized) |
| { |
| // Update fields from EC |
| Store (BDC0, Index (PBIF, 1)) // Batt Design Capacity |
| Store (BFC0, Index (PBIF, 2)) // Batt Last Full Charge Capacity |
| Store (BDV0, Index (PBIF, 4)) // Batt Design Voltage |
| Divide(BFC0, 0x64, Local0, Local1) |
| Multiply(Local1, 0x0A, Local0) |
| Store(Local0, Index(PBIF, 5)) |
| Multiply(Local1, 0x05, Local0) |
| Store (Local0, Index (PBIF, 6)) |
| Store (ToString(BATD), Index (PBIF, 9)) // Model Number |
| Store (ToDecimalString(BSN0), Index (PBIF, 10)) // Serial Number |
| Store (ToString(BCHM), Index (PBIF, 11)) // Battery Type |
| Store (\BATV, Index (PBIF, 12)) // OEM information |
| |
| Return (PBIF) |
| } |
| |
| Method (_BST, 0, Serialized) |
| { |
| // |
| // 0: BATTERY STATE |
| // |
| // bit 0 = discharging |
| // bit 1 = charging |
| // bit 2 = critical level |
| // |
| |
| // Get battery state from EC |
| Store (BST0, Local0) |
| Store (Local0, Index (PBST, 0)) |
| |
| // |
| // 1: BATTERY PRESENT RATE/CURRENT |
| // |
| Store (BPC0, Local1) |
| If (LAnd (Local1, 0x8000)) { |
| Xor (Local1, 0xFFFF, Local1) |
| Increment (Local1) |
| } |
| Store (Local1, Index (PBST, 1)) |
| |
| // |
| // 2: BATTERY REMAINING CAPACITY |
| // |
| Store (BRC0, Local1) |
| |
| If (LAnd (BFWK, LAnd (ADPT, LNot (Local0)))) { |
| // On AC power and battery is neither charging |
| // nor discharging. Linux expects a full battery |
| // to report same capacity as last full charge. |
| // https://bugzilla.kernel.org/show_bug.cgi?id=12632 |
| Store (BFC0, Local2) |
| |
| // See if within ~3% of full |
| ShiftRight (Local2, 5, Local3) |
| If (LAnd (LGreater (Local1, Subtract (Local2, Local3)), |
| LLess (Local1, Add (Local2, Local3)))) |
| { |
| Store (Local2, Local1) |
| } |
| } |
| Store (Local1, Index (PBST, 2)) |
| |
| // |
| // 3: BATTERY PRESENT VOLTAGE |
| // |
| Store (BPV0, Index (PBST, 3)) |
| |
| Return (PBST) |
| } |
| } |
